Student Population by Gender

Hodges University has a total of 443 enrolled students for the academic year 2022-2023. 339 students have enrolled in undergraduate programs and 104 students joined graduate programs.
By gender, 140 male and 303 female students (the male-female ratio is 32:68) are attending the school. The gender distribution is based on the 2022-2023 data.

Student Distribution by Race/Ethnicity

By race/ethnicity, 152 White, 63 Black, and 7 Asian students out of a total of 443 are attending at Hodges University. Comprehensive enrollment statistic data by race/ethnicity is shown in the next chart (Academic year 2022-2023 data).

Online Student Enrollment

Distance learning, also called online education, is very attractive to students, especially who want to continue education and work in field. At Hodges University, 207 students are enrolled exclusively in online courses and 171 students are enrolled in some online courses.
183 students lived in Florida or jurisdiction in which the school is located are enrolled exclusively in online courses and 24 students live in other State or outside of the United States.

Transfer-in Students (Undergraduate)

Among 339 enrolled in undergraduate programs, 43 students have transferred-in from other institutions. The percentage of transfer-in students is 12.68%.31 students have transferred in as full-time status and 12 students transferred in as part-time status.
